AI Analysis — Bull vs Bear

Anthropic anthropic claude-opus-4.6 18d ago
AI opinion · based on fundamentals
Risk high

PNC Infratech trades at a PE of 7.4x and 0.90x book value with a market cap of Rs.6,134 Cr, reflecting significant de-rating after a TTM sales decline of 21% and profit decline of 42%. The company has reduced debt but faces deteriorating working capital cycles and elevated contingent liabilities of Rs.3,595 Cr.

Bull Case 7
  • Stock trades at 0.90x price-to-book, below its book value, suggesting deep valuation discount relative to assets
  • PE ratio of 7.4x is significantly below infrastructure sector averages, pricing in substantial pessimism
  • Company has actively reduced debt, improving balance sheet strength
  • 10-year compounded profit growth of 8% and sales growth of 7% demonstrate long-term execution capability
  • 5-year average ROE of 14% and 10-year average ROE of 15% indicate historically strong capital efficiency
  • Stock has declined 24% over the past year, potentially offering a contrarian entry if fundamentals stabilize
  • Infrastructure sector benefits from continued government capex push on highways and roads in India
Bear Case 8
  • TTM sales declined 21% and TTM profit declined 42%, showing sharp deterioration in business momentum
  • Working capital days have surged from 72.1 to 160 days, indicating severe cash conversion stress and potential liquidity strain
  • Contingent liabilities of Rs.3,595 Cr represent roughly 59% of market cap, posing material risk if crystallized
  • Debtor days increased from 79.7 to 103 days, reflecting delayed collections from clients
  • Last year ROE collapsed to 7% from a 3-year average of 13%, signaling declining profitability
  • Low interest coverage ratio indicates vulnerability to debt servicing pressures
  • Earnings quality is questionable with Rs.634 Cr of other income included in profits
  • Dividend payout of only 1.81% of profits over last 3 years shows minimal shareholder returns despite 0.25% yield

  • HAM pacts worth Rs 3483 Cr Jul 17

    PNC Infratech signed concession agreements with NHAI for two HAM projects worth Rs 3483 crore, involving construction of 4-lane highways in Uttar Pradesh.

Company Information

PNC Infratech Limited was incorporated on 9th August 1999 as PNC Construction Company Private Limited. The Company was converted into a limited company in 2001 and was renamed PNC Infratech limited in 2007. PNC Infratech Limited is one of the front-ending infrastructure development, construction, and management companies in the country. The company undertakes infrastructure projects, including highways, bridges, flyovers, power transmission lines and towers, airport runways, industrial area development, and other infrastructure activities.[1]
